My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

Raider is a loving and affectionate dog that is looking for the perfect family to love him. He loves playing with other animals, dogs and cats, as well as his toys. He enjoys couch time after a good play session. Raider has a lot of energy and benefits from long walks or running around the yard. He is working on his crate training and basic obedient since he still is a puppy. Raider does have a history of seizures and needs an experienced adopted since he will likely be on medication his entire life, although the medication is inexpensive. Raider does well with dogs, kids, and cats. He is neutered, up to date on all vaccines, and chipped. All Better World Rescue dogs come with complimentary group or private training to help ensure a successful adoption.
